Research And Implementation Of Software Radio Board Based On FPGA

After several decades of development,mobile communication technology has been the era of the3G. The current LTE (Long Term Evolution) has started commercial. Mobile Internet users continue to increase. The user data traffic continues to increase and the communication rate is rising along with changes in technology, that brings power increasing. The increasing cost of enormous challenges to the present wireless mobile communication network. The new base station platform using the technology of software radio base station platform, which power consumption and the cost is greatly reduced compared with the traditional,and also has a high performance, scalability, good stability etc. That makes the software radio technology based on general purpose processor has become a hotspot, and gradually becoming the realization of LTE base station has the most potential for the future technology. The work of this thesis focus on the research and hardware signal gathering board based on Software defined Radio realization.In this thesis, the system architecture of software radio is made a specific analysis. The performance comparison are made for the chips which can complete the function considering the cost,reliability, complexity of implementation and other factors. Finally we determine use the Virtex-6type XC6VLX130T FPGA as the core board-signal gathering board processor, which can meet the system hardware platform and data rate. Finally, this thesis puts forward the concrete realization of the target signal gathering board.This thesis makes detailed study and design about the various functional circuit on the signal convergence board.The main work includes the PCI-Express golden finger design,clock circuit design, power module design. QDR and DDR3design,interface design. Flash configuration circuit design,reset circuit design and high speed serial interface circuit etc.On the basis of above design, this thesis analyzes the signal integrity of the main signal on gathering board, including GTX signal, RocketIO signal, high-speed clock signal. It provides guiding references for hardware PCB layout, to ensure the stability of the board.At the end of the software radio system was tested and verified, including between the key module card and signal gathering board and the daughter board debugging main work, achieves the goal of design.
